Abstract

In bibliometric and scientometric research, the quantitative assessment of scientific impact has boomed over the past few decades. Citations, being playing a major role in enhancing the impact of researchers, have become a very significant part of a plethora of new techniques for measuring scientific impact. Self-citations, though can be used genuinely to credit someone’s own work, can play a significant role in artificial manipulation of scientific impact. In this research, we study the impact of self-citations on enhancing the scientific impact of an author using a dataset retrieved from AMiner ranging from 1936 to 2014 from the computer science domain. We investigated the relations among trends of self-citation and their influence on scientific impact. We also studied its influence on ranking metrics including author impact factor and H-Index. By analyzing self-citations over time, we discover five basic self-citation trends, which are early, middle, later, multi and none. Distinctly different patterns were observed in self-citations trends. The results show that self-citations, if totally removed from total received citations, negatively influence the AIF and H-Index values and hence can be used to artificially boost the scientific impact. We used regression-based prediction models to predict the influence of self-citations on future H-Index. Classifiers including Logistic Regression, Naïve Bayes and K-NN were used with an accuracy of 93%, 73% and 60% respectively.
